SATURDAY, FEBRUARY 14 - WALK ON!

On Saturday, February 14, there's a sponsored dog walk taking place in the north of the island - and you're invited to take part. Organised by OLGA - the Old League of Gentlemen of Alcudia - the walk departs at 10.30am the from "Bridge to Nowhere" in Pto Alcudia, along the coastline to Ca'n Picafort, and back (a total distance of 18 kilometres). All money raised is going to Victoria's Animal Refuge, so that they can rebuild their dog homing centre, which was recently devastated by floods.

OLGA has already presented 750 euros to the charity and hopes to raise a lot more through the sponsored walk.

Get your sponsorship form from Bar Oceano (which is offering some fun prizes for the event), from the Refuge charity shop or the Talk of the North office in Pto Pollensa.

If you don't have a dog but would like to take part, there are plenty of dogs available for you to "borrow"!
